■ TreeListView 엘리먼트의 KeyFieldName/ParentFieldName 속성 사용해 트리 구조 데이터를 바인딩하는 방법을 보여준다. (TreeDerivationMode 속성 : Selfreference)
▶ 예제 코드 (XAML)
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 |
<Grid xmlns:dxg="http://schemas.devexpress.com/winfx/2008/xaml/grid"> <dxg:GridControl x:Name="gridControl"> <dxg:GridControl.Columns> <dxg:GridColumn FieldName="Name" Header="Employee Name" /> <dxg:GridColumn FieldName="Position" /> <dxg:GridColumn FieldName="Department" /> </dxg:GridControl.Columns> <dxg:GridControl.View> <dxg:TreeListView x:Name="treeListView" AutoWidth="False" KeyFieldName="ID" ParentFieldName="ParentID" TreeDerivationMode="Selfreference" /> </dxg:GridControl.View> </dxg:GridControl> </Grid> |